diff options
| author | Liguros - Gitlab CI/CD [develop] <gitlab@liguros.net> | 2025-07-21 22:01:01 +0000 |
|---|---|---|
| committer | Liguros - Gitlab CI/CD [develop] <gitlab@liguros.net> | 2025-07-21 22:01:01 +0000 |
| commit | 2a2c8c66b53a98c415ccba9454719b07090df143 (patch) | |
| tree | e51e79bae004a1290a65b1b5eef1576ae98a79c5 /media-libs/vulkan-loader | |
| parent | 998d1ef77e5c341697abbd8a7daaf28243e47cda (diff) | |
| download | baldeagleos-repo-2a2c8c66b53a98c415ccba9454719b07090df143.tar.gz baldeagleos-repo-2a2c8c66b53a98c415ccba9454719b07090df143.tar.xz baldeagleos-repo-2a2c8c66b53a98c415ccba9454719b07090df143.zip | |
Adding metadata
Diffstat (limited to 'media-libs/vulkan-loader')
| -rw-r--r-- | media-libs/vulkan-loader/Manifest | 1 | ||||
| -rw-r--r-- | media-libs/vulkan-loader/vulkan-loader-1.4.309.0.ebuild | 60 |
2 files changed, 0 insertions, 61 deletions
diff --git a/media-libs/vulkan-loader/Manifest b/media-libs/vulkan-loader/Manifest index 459508f12d98..f570f8541f61 100644 --- a/media-libs/vulkan-loader/Manifest +++ b/media-libs/vulkan-loader/Manifest @@ -1,2 +1 @@ -DIST vulkan-loader-1.4.309.0.tar.gz 1761949 BLAKE2B 1edbd34ba914beaedb3c6eb48863241c3d7a09147a534a5160f85c251bf4165579bf0c929843aef915297208f7f00244b8f7206b078be08cd845e4232837ef79 SHA512 f77d42639037b79eeeba4007eded039527a345cd39ed1b6a3c5e786a418c481811a72c43cb24821268c7bc57c39941cfe5511e86362ac892c51d45a062dc0e2c DIST vulkan-loader-1.4.313.0.tar.gz 1757076 BLAKE2B afa2ffadd85df1c31d27c942154275e967b3dda3afa233da6a38493aefbb0a38e2e92964eaf071c15ffc72205276b6fe2fd1558629ebef7cc6bcfa622290bb8d SHA512 70eee07ec9f15ac809117c2ba951ca88995c8241d5eb94faf20e884d94078f7a36d26b5064fc60f32ecf0e087b5c8150fda3f4848a2b5160afc499eb775e6ee8 diff --git a/media-libs/vulkan-loader/vulkan-loader-1.4.309.0.ebuild b/media-libs/vulkan-loader/vulkan-loader-1.4.309.0.ebuild deleted file mode 100644 index f255abf97918..000000000000 --- a/media-libs/vulkan-loader/vulkan-loader-1.4.309.0.ebuild +++ /dev/null @@ -1,60 +0,0 @@ -# Copyright 1999-2025 Gentoo Authors -# Distributed under the terms of the GNU General Public License v2 - -EAPI=8 - -MY_PN=Vulkan-Loader -inherit flag-o-matic cmake-multilib toolchain-funcs - -if [[ ${PV} == *9999* ]]; then - EGIT_REPO_URI="https://github.com/KhronosGroup/${MY_PN}.git" - EGIT_SUBMODULES=() - inherit git-r3 -else - SRC_URI="https://github.com/KhronosGroup/${MY_PN}/archive/vulkan-sdk-${PV}.tar.gz -> ${P}.tar.gz" - KEYWORDS="amd64 arm arm64 ~loong ppc ppc64 ~riscv x86" - S="${WORKDIR}"/${MY_PN}-vulkan-sdk-${PV} -fi - -DESCRIPTION="Vulkan Installable Client Driver (ICD) Loader" -HOMEPAGE="https://github.com/KhronosGroup/Vulkan-Loader" - -LICENSE="Apache-2.0" -SLOT="0" -IUSE="layers wayland X" - -DEPEND=" - ~dev-util/vulkan-headers-${PV} - wayland? ( dev-libs/wayland:=[${MULTILIB_USEDEP}] ) - X? ( - x11-base/xorg-proto - x11-libs/libX11:=[${MULTILIB_USEDEP}] - x11-libs/libXrandr:=[${MULTILIB_USEDEP}] - ) -" -PDEPEND="layers? ( media-libs/vulkan-layers[${MULTILIB_USEDEP}] )" - -multilib_src_configure() { - # Integrated clang assembler doesn't work with x86 - Bug #698164 - if tc-is-clang && [[ ${ABI} == x86 ]]; then - append-cflags -fno-integrated-as - fi - - local mycmakeargs=( - -DCMAKE_C_FLAGS="${CFLAGS} -DNDEBUG" - -DCMAKE_CXX_FLAGS="${CXXFLAGS} -DNDEBUG" - -DCMAKE_SKIP_RPATH=ON - -DBUILD_TESTS=OFF - -DBUILD_WSI_WAYLAND_SUPPORT=$(usex wayland) - -DBUILD_WSI_XCB_SUPPORT=$(usex X) - -DBUILD_WSI_XLIB_SUPPORT=$(usex X) - -DVULKAN_HEADERS_INSTALL_DIR="${ESYSROOT}/usr" - ) - cmake_src_configure -} - -multilib_src_install() { - keepdir /etc/vulkan/icd.d - - cmake_src_install -} |
